PARADISE INN @ SUNWAY PRAMID

September 13, 2014 by StrawberrY Gal

Located in Sunway Pyramid, Paradise Inn comes with the simple and charming interior but also brings us with the authentic yet affordable and comfort Chinese classic dishes. The restaurant brings us with lots of surprises this round where they have more to served and enjoy.
PARADISE INN
Started with Double Boil Water Goby with Fresh Apple Soup (RM42.90) where the soup is being double boiled where this is the Chinese techniwues which is being used to prepare a delicate dishes where the awesome one pot of soup is being boiled and steamed in another pot of water to ensure no loss of essence during the process.It is being served with the spare ribs flavours while their recipe comes balanced with the natural sweetness of appleas and water goby. It is such a hearty temptations to start off. This is also good for the lungs and claims to re-energise the mind too.

PARADISE INN
I love the Shrimp Paste Chicken – RM18.90 (S) RM27.90 (M) RM36.90 (L) which is well deep fried till perfection and you can taste the crispiness of the wings itself and also the juiciness of the shrimp paste. Not only that, it is well packed with flavours in it. I could say “Finger Lickering Good”.

PARADISE INN
One of the signatures which I would give 2 thumbs up is the Steamed Minced Pork with Salted Fish & Waterchestnut (RM18.90). The blending of minced water chestnut and minced pork together makes a good combination It is as good as it is and every mouthful is divinely good.

PARADISE INN
Crisp – Fried Crystal Prawns with Wasabi Mayo sauce (RM29.90 (S) RM44.90 (M) RM59.90 (L)) being one of the signature in Paradise Inn where it comes with a kick of wasabi hint in it; the wasabi comes fiercy hot and very appetizing. Best of all, these prawns were absolutely succulent and completely de-shelled!

PARADISE INN
Coming next is the Braised Vermicelli with Pork Trotters (RM19.90 (S) RM29.90 (M) RM39.90 (L)) is simply something to look for. The vermicelli was amazingly flavourful with the tender pork trotter. The taste is sinfully good with the deliciously done and every mouthful blend is simply awesome.

PARADISE INN
Mixed Fruit Salad with Tea-Smoked Duck (RM29.90) is something worth to try here. The duck is well smoked with the light blend tea mixed with combination of mustard sauce in it. The smoked ducks comes juicilicious with the healthy blend of fruit salad with it.

PARADISE INN
As for the Fried Scallop with Special Chilies (RM 33.90); the juici-licious scallop comes awesome and it is being deep fried till perfection. It is stir fried with the spicy peppercorn with it and I love the plup juiciness of the scallops that is being served with it. Nice!

PARADISE INN
The Stew “WuXi” Pork RIbs being the award signature dish is something to look forward in Paradise Inn. The pork ribs is being deep fried and it is then being slow cooked for 2 hours with the added white wine in it brings us with the fragrant and awesome taste. The delighting dish is simply awesome, and with the mantau served with it I would give two thumbs up!
PARADISE INN

Aside from the ala-carte delights, we had the Seafood with Spicy Homemade Sauce. Served together with an appetizers with the soup; it is indeed an appetizing and delicious.

= PARADISE INN
Fiercy Tender CHicken in “Kong Bao” Sauce (RM19.90++) where it is  filled with the kungbao aroma with the tender juicy chicken, the set is simply just good and lovely.

*All prices are subjected to 10% service charges and 6% government tax

Paradise Inn, Sunway Pyramid,
OB3, LG1.7 & LG1.8 (near Jusco & Starbucks),
Oasis Boulevard, West Wing, Sunway Pyramid.
Tel: 03-5637-8822
